Be Flexible with Showings
Make your home as accessible as possible for potential buyers. Be flexible with showing schedules, even if it means accommodating last-minute requests. The more opportunities buyers have to see your home, the quicker it’s likely to sell.
Consider Homebuying Companies
If you’re in a significant hurry to sell and are willing to accept a lower offer, consider working with homebuying companies. These companies specialize in quick sales and can offer a cash deal, bypassing the traditional selling process.
Pre-Inspection and Repairs
Getting a pre-inspection can help you identify and address any issues that might deter buyers. Repairing known issues upfront can prevent last-minute negotiations or deal breakers during the closing process.
Be prepared to Negotiate
In a hurry, you might need to be more flexible during negotiations. Be open to reasonable offers, and consider concessions to close the deal quickly. It’s a balance between getting a fair price and meeting your urgent needs.
Be mindful of Legal and Financial Aspects
Selling a home involves various legal and financial aspects. Be prepared for closing costs, potential taxes, and any legal documentation required for the sale. Consulting with a real estate attorney can be beneficial.
Have a Backup Plan
In some cases, a quick sale might not materialize. It’s essential to have a backup plan, such as renting the property temporarily or exploring other financial options if the sale doesn’t go through as quickly as expected.
